Sealed bids will be received by the City of Sioux City, City in the City Purchasing Office located on Fourth Floor in City Hall, 405 Sixth Street, in Sioux City Iowa, until 3:00 P.M., Local Time, April 24, 2025, for the construction of the project, as described in the construction documents. The project is located at the Tyson Events Center, 401 Gordon Drive and includes the replacement of a portion of the exterior lighting at the south façade of the Tyson Events Center with new color changing lighting and associated controls. The existing Tyson Events Center roof heat tape system at the eastern side of the roof will be replaced with a new ice melt / heat tape system.
Bids received will be opened and tabulated at a public meeting, presided over by City Staff, in the Purchasing Office, City Hall, Room 408, at 3:00 P.M., Local Time, on April 24, 2025. Thereafter, bids will be acted upon by the City Council at such time and place as may be fixed.
A pre-bid meeting will be held on April 17, 2025 at 2:30 P.M. at the Tyson Events Center, 401 Gordon Drive. Interested contractors shall meet in the lobby. It is strongly recommended that interested contractors attend the pre-bid meeting, and/or visit the site prior to bidding.
Each bid must be made on a form furnished by the City and must be accompanied by a bid bond, a cashier’s check or certified check of an Iowa bank or a bank chartered under the laws of the United States, or a certified share draft drawn on a credit union in Iowa or chartered under the laws of the United States, in an amount equal to ten percent (10%) of the amount of the bid, made payable to the City Treasurer of the City of Sioux City, Iowa. The check or draft may be cashed by the City Treasurer as liquidated damages in the event the successful bidder fails to enter into a contract within the ten (10) days after notice of award and post bond satisfactory to the City ensuring the faithful fulfillment of the contract.
The contract will be awarded to the lowest responsive, responsible bidder. However, the City reserves the right to reject any or all bids, readvertise for new bids and to waive informalities that may be in the best interest of the City. By virtue of statutory authority, a preference will be given to products and provisions grown and coal produced within the state of Iowa and to Iowa domestic labor.
The work on this project shall begin upon receipt of the Notice to Proceed and be fully completed by August 22, 2025.
